FINRA has suspended financial advisor Timothy James Pandekakes (CRD No. 4890164) from the securities industry for three months and ordered him to pay partial restitution of $20,000.

FINRA alleged that between January 2016 and April 2018, while employed by Cadaret, Grant & Co., Inc. in Bronxville, New York, Mr. Pandekakes recommended four unsuitable exchanges of variable annuities, in violation of FINRA Rules 2111, 2330, and 2010.

Timothy Pandekakes was a financial advisor at Cadaret, Grant & Co., Inc. from December 2004 through June 2019.   During the same period, he was also affiliated with MDIC Investment Company in Bronxville, New York.  According to public records, Mr. Pandekakes’ employment was terminated by Cadaret, Grant & Co., Inc. in June 2019 for engaging in investment practices inconsistent with firm expectations.
